The company said production of the Tiago, Tigor, Nexon and Sierra has been affected due to the floods.
The Sanand facility is one of Tata Motors’ key passenger vehicle manufacturing plants and produces several of the company’s high-volume models.
The disruption comes as Tata Motors navigates a slowdown in domestic passenger vehicle demand. The company sold 45,199 passenger vehicles in India in July, down 11% from 50,701 units a year earlier. Total domestic sales, including electric vehicles, also declined during the month, reflecting softer industry demand.
The Nexon remained among Tata Motors’ best-selling SUVs during the period, while the company has been preparing to ramp up production of the Sierra ahead of its market launch.
Investors appeared to look past the temporary disruption, with Tata Motors shares ending 1.28% higher at ₹411.35 on the NSE.
